分享

目前微信公众号上传图片的一些事

 骑火一川 2017-03-17

目前公众号文章里的配图格式基本就是三种:JPG、PNG、GIF。


简单介绍一下:

Gif适合矢量图和颜色比较少的图片。它的色彩效果最低,对于色彩比较丰富的图片容易失真,但是有个极大的优势:体积小,并且支持透明效果。因为它还可以做成小动画,所有还有人叫它动图。

JPG(Jpeg)特点是色彩还原好,可以在照片不明显失真的情况下,大幅降低体积,不支持透明。照片类的图片、自然风景之类的最好都用JPG。

PNG的优点是清晰、无损压缩、可渐变透明,具备几乎所有GIF的优点,但是不如JPG的颜色丰富,同样的图片体积也比JPG略大。另外,大部分的手机截图都用该格式。

大小比较:PNG ≥ JPG > GIF

色彩丰富程度:JPG > PNG >GIF

透明性:PNG > GIF > JPG(不透明)


关于图片压缩,有2个概念大家需要知道:有损压缩、无损压缩。

有损压缩:特点是保持颜色的逐渐变化,因为减少了像素点的数据信息,所以存储量会降低,但会影响图像的还原度,画质会有所下降。JPG是有损压缩格式,在存储图像时会把图像分解成8*8像素的网格单独优化,这就是平时保存JPG图片时图像会模糊的原因。

无损压缩:利用数据的统计冗余进行压缩,真实的记录图像上每个像素点的数据信息,多次存储后图片的品质不会下降。为什么无损压缩的图也会有失真的?因为他的压缩原理是通过索引图像上相同区域的颜色进行压缩和还原,也就是说只有在图像的颜色数量小于我们可以保存的颜色数量时,才能真实的记录和还原图像,否则就会丢失一些图像信息。例如PNG8和GIF格式,而PNG24为真彩色,不会失真。


在公众号后台对于图像的使用,我们需要考虑图片的使用场景以及色彩情况,然后再去把图片保存为不同格式使用,不是你找高清大图就意味着上传微信后也是高清的。微信公众号后台图片上传,图片尺寸不大时,基本没什么影响。但是,当图片体积较大或尺寸较大时会被自动压缩上传。


jpg格式图片:
首先这种格式的大图上传微信后台不能超过5M,总像素不能超过600万。图像大于5M或总像素超过600万,均不允许上传;

其次在满足上面的情况下,如果图像横向 (宽度) 像素超过1280像素(px),上传后会被自动压缩到1280 像素,竖向根据比例压缩,当宽度为1280像素时,高度最高不超过4687像素。在原图横向像素低于1280像素的情况下,竖向像素最多不能超过10000像素,超过10000像素会不请允许上传。


png格式图片

首先这种格式的大图上传微信后台不能超过5M,总像素不能超过600万。图像大于5M或总像素超过600万,均不允许上传;

其次在满足上面的情况下,图像横向 (宽度) 像素没有1280像素的限制,但在Photoshop里横向宽度超过30000像素,已经不能保存PNG格式了。在微信后台上传横向30000像素的图片依旧可以。原图竖向像素最多不能超过10000像素,超过10000像素同样不允许上传。也就是说这种格式的图像只要能上传到微信后台,就不会被自动压缩,最高可上传30000*10000像素的图像。


gif格式图片:

首先首先这种格式的大图上传微信后台不能超过2M,总像素不能超过600万。图像大于2M或总像素超过600万,均不允许上传;

其次在满足上面的情况下,图像横向 (宽度) 像素没有1280像素的限制,但在Photoshop里横向宽度超过30000像素,已经不能保存gif格式了。在微信后台上传横向30000像素的图片依旧可以。原图竖向像素最多不能超过10000像素,超过10000像素同样不允许上传。也就是说这种格式的图像只要能上传到微信后台,就不会被自动压缩,最高可上传30000*10000像素的图像。这种情形与PNG格式的一样。


所以说,图片上传也是有策略的,如果都是在上传JPG格式的图片,就会发现自己公众号的图片没有别人的高清。现在有不少手机是2K屏(2560*1440的分辨率),还有索尼的Xperia Z5 Premium手机是4K屏(3840x2160像素),在一些场景下会有对高清图的需求。



对于色彩简单的大图上传,gif格式比较适合,但是当画面色彩比较丰富,gif格式就很可能会失真。有高度浓缩并快捷传达信息、颜色数量较少的图片,比如图形图像类,文字类图片。一般可以使用PNG格式或者GIF格式,优化时可采用PNG格式为PNG8或者PNG24。

而对于通常含有百万数量级的颜色,包括平滑的颜色过度和渐变,比较复杂的图片,一般可以用PNG和JPG,根据图片色彩的丰富程度而定。


一句话如果使用的是高清大图,因超过微信后台正常尺寸,图片会被压缩。这个时候,一般可以使用GIF格式图片,图片越大越清晰,上传后的清晰度也越高。而如果是色彩比较复杂的图片,用GIF格式失真比较厉害,也可以考虑下使用PNG24格式,因为PNG24为无损压缩,减少失真。


注:文中的像素大小图取自爱否科技的视频截图

「FView 出品」索尼Z5 Premium消费者报告




    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多